What are some of the uses for carbide?

Calcium carbide is used in steelmaking as a fuel and a powerful deoxidizer. It is also used in the production of carbide lamps but has been relatively phased out of all mining operations.

In metalworking what is the use of carbide burrs?

There are many uses of carbide burrs in metalworking. These burrs act as cutting tools in many grinder tools such as dental drills, rotary tools, and die grinders.


Is silicon carbide used in cutting tools?

Silicon carbide is a compound of silicon and carbon with chemical formula SiC. Silicon carbide was discovered by the American inventor Edward G. Acheson in 1891. Some cutting tools are created with Silicon carbide.


What is Carbide?

"Carbide" as used in "Carbide Drills" and "Carbide Saws" is the alloy Tungsten Carbide. Chemically the material is either Tungsten Carbide (WC) or Tungsten diCarbide (WC2). Carbide is used because of its hardness.

What are some quality tools for carbide tooling?

Some quality tools for carbide tooling include: Carbide inserts: These are replaceable cutting tips made of carbide that can be mounted on tool holders for machining operations. They provide excellent wear resistance and can handle high cutting speeds. Solid carbide end mills: These are milling tools that feature a solid carbide construction. They are capable of high-speed cutting and provide superior rigidity, allowing for precise and efficient machining. Carbide drills: Carbide drills are used for drilling holes in various materials. They have a sharp cutting edge and high heat resistance, enabling them to withstand the demands of drilling through hard materials like steel and cast iron.

Which carbide is used for preparing acetylene?

This is calcium carbide - CaC2.
